Job Description
The Sacramento Kings are searching for a seasoned marketing professional to serve in the exciting role of Director of Marketing. This leadership position oversees programs that drive brand interest, fan engagement, and revenue. The person in this role should be a master collaborator, managing key internal relationships for Marketing with departments including Global Partnerships, Digital, Entertainment, Retail, Social Responsibility, and Tech Ops, as well as external relationships with vendors and agency partners. They will have a proven track record of aligning stakeholders and translating business objectives into successful marketing plans. The ideal candidate will also have a passion for fan development, motivated by the opportunity to nurture individuals from a variety of segments toward greater engagement. As a strategic thought partner with the VP, of Marketing, they will help lead the team, grow the global Kings fanbase, and reach our business goals.
Key Responsibility Areas:
• Manage and mentor direct reports. Collaborate with the VP, Marketing and two Director-level peers within the department to set strategies, operate the department, and connect the dots across the organization to uncover new opportunities.
• Liaise between internal department clients and our award-winning team of designers. Translate business objectives into thoughtful creative briefs and manage the process via Asana.
• Serve as a strategic thought partner with the Global Partnerships team to help develop opportunities that can generate revenue and be mutually beneficial to the team and partner brands. Leverage partnerships to generate fan engagement. Help ensure cobranded programs maintain brand standards.
• Drive collaboration among stakeholders for themed games, fan giveaways, and experiences that create unforgettable moments for our guests. Support the creative needs of our Sacramento Kings Dancers, mascot, and other Entertainment team requests.
• Lead initiatives to grow and engage the universe of Kings fans. Use technology, data, and understanding of market trends to create innovative programs and personalized experiences that grow fandom.
• Collaborate with Digital, Content, Retail, and Social Responsibility teams to develop internal content, implement marketing initiatives, and maintain brand consistency across digital channels.

Qualifications:
• Bachelor's degree (BA/BS) from a four-year College or university in Marketing, Communications, Business, or a related field.
• 8+ years of marketing experience, ideally with a team, agency, or consumer brand, with 3+ years in a leadership role
Compensation:
The base salary range for this exempt role is $100,000 - $110,000 + 10% annual discretionary bonus. Final offers for this role will be made within the parameters of the salary range provided. Years of experience, skills, and other factors are considered when determining the salary offered. Total compensation & offer package will include the following:
• Comprehensive Medical, Dental, and Vision benefits for employees and dependents
• Self-Directed Time Off + 11 Paid Holidays
• Employer 401(k) match
• Cell Phone Stipend
